Kanetada Nagamine Kusuo Nishiyama Jun Imazato Hisayoshi Nakayama Masayuki Yoshida Yoichi Sakai Haruo Sato Takeshi Tominaga 《Chemical physics letters》1982,87(2):186-191
The relaxation rate of muonium in pure water has been found to be smaller than 0.05 × 106 s?1. With the aid of pulsed muong. μSR and MuSR measurements have been carried out over a longer time range than ever achieved. The results indicate a stability of thermal muonium in water from 3 to 29°C. 相似文献

T. Sambongi K. Tsutsumi Y. Shiozaki M. Yamamoto K. Yamaya Y. Abe 《Solid State Communications》1977,22(12):729-731
Transition-metal trichalcogenide, TaS3, with an orthorhombic structure was found to undergo a metal-semiconductor transition at 270 K. Electron diffraction reveals diffuse scattering above room temperature and superlattice spots at a lower temperature. These phenomena are interpreted in terms of Peierls transition. 相似文献

This paper proposes a new pair of sequences whose cross-correlation values are zero except for the peak value and presents a new modulation method for an ultrasonic Doppler flowmeter with high sensitivity utilizing these sequences. In this method, transmitted and received waves are modulated and demodulated, respectively, by the specified new sequences. Since unfavourable reflected waves can be almost completely eliminated by this proposed modulation method, a high signal-to-noise ratio is easily achieved. Elementary experimental results are also given. 相似文献

The adsorption of CO on Ni was investigated by quantum chemical calculations using the CNDO/2 tight binding method. The surfaces used as models are the (111), 4(111) × (111), 3(111) × (110) and 3(111) × (100) surfaces. The CO bond is weakened in this sequence of surfaces. The active sites for the CO bond fission are the trench regions of the step and kink structures. The Ni 3d orbitals play an important role for the weakening of the CO bond, though their contribution is small for the Ni-C bond formation. 相似文献

Yousuke Kurosaki Hisashi Mogi Hiroyasu Fujii Takeshi Kubota Morio Shiozaki 《Journal of magnetism and magnetic materials》2008
In order to reduce energy loss in motors, the use of high-efficiency non-oriented electrical steel sheets and an optimal motor core design are important. It is also crucial to minimize the deterioration of magnetic properties during the motor core manufacturing process. Accordingly, this report evaluates the effects of cutting and clamping methods on the deterioration factors of motor cores. Magnetic properties are largely influenced by both cutting and clamping methods. While it is difficult to avoid cutting and clamping altogether, it is necessary to adopt suitable production conditions and minimize the deterioration involved. 相似文献
